حاسوب تحضير لبجروت C# / Java (مادة عاشر + حادي عشر)

عن الكورس
محتوى الكورس
  • 3 Sections
  • 50 Lessons
إخفاء الجميع

دورة مكثفة وشاملة لتحضير طلاب الحاسوب لبجروت ال5 وحدات. تركز الدورة على بناء الأساسيات البرمجية بلغات JAVA / C# وصولاً إلى المفاهيم المعقدة في هياكل البيانات والنجاعة، مع تطبيق عملي وحل اسئلة للتمرن والتقوية.


:أبرز نقاط الدورة

  • أساسيات البرمجة والمتغيرات (יסודות התכנות ומשתנים):int, double, char, string...

  • عمليات الإدخال والإخراج (קלט ופלט): التحكم في الطباعة على الشاشة واستقبال البيانات من المستخدم.

  • الجمل الشرطية (מבני בקרה והתניה): إتقان التعامل مع if / else if / else

  •   حلقات التكرار (לולאות): التمكن من استخدام في حل المسائل التكرارية while و for

  • الدوال والوحدات البرمجية (פונקציות ומתודות): فهم وظيفة الدوال وكيفية استدعائها واستعمالها.

  • المصفوفات (מערכים): دراسة المصفوفات الأحادية والثنائية (מערך חד-מימדי ודו-מימדי).

  • النصوص والسلاسل (מחרוזות - String): التوسع في التعامل مع النصوص كمصفوفة حرفية.

  • البرمجة كائنية التوجه (تعدد الكائنات - מחלקות ועצמים): شرح class, Get / Set / ToString...

  • تحليل النجاعة (סיבוכיות זמן ריצה): فهم زمن النجاعة للخوارزميات المختلفة لضمان كود مثالي.

  • ريكورسيا (רקורסיה): فهم كيفية عمل الريكورسيا وتطبيقها في حل المسائل المعقدة.

  • هياكل البيانات - الراصة والدور (מחסנית ותור): إتقان التعامل مع الـ Stack والـ Queue وتطبيقاتهما.

  • القوائم المنسقة (רשימה מקושרת): فهم الـNode وكيفية بناء وإدارة السلاسل والحلقات البرمجية.

  • الأشجار (עצים): دراسة هياكل البيانات الشجرية Tree وكيفية التعامل معها.

  • تحليل النجاعة المتقدم (סיבוכיות זמן ריצה): تقييم أداء الكود وضمان عمله بأقصى سرعة ممكنة.

  • حل نماذج من امتحانات מה״ט القريبة جدًا من البجروت وامتحانات المعلمين: تدريب عملي على الأسئلة الرسمية لضمان الجاهزية القصوى.

Deleting Course Review

Are you sure? You can't restore this back

Course Access

This course is password protected. To access it please enter your password below:

تمرير للأعلى